Late Shipping.
THE MOURA.
(Special to Tunis.) Napier, last night. The steamer Moura sailed for Gisborno at 5 pan. Passengers : Messrs Rainbow, Mentiplay, Bridge, Ellis, and Master Saut.
By Telegraph. Press Association. Copyright Newcastle, Juno 4. Sailed, Elmville, for Auckland. Auckland, last night. Sailed, at 8.30 pan., the Omaperc, for Gisborne (via East Coast ports).
Yesterday afternoon the following had booked passages by the steamer Moura for Auckland : Mesdames Kennedy and daughter, Martin, Wade, Hosfcll, Nelson and child, Kirk ; Misses Gilmour (2), Colley, Agnes; Messrs Williamson, Hogan, Barry, Oman (2), Branson, White Kennedy, Jury, McCabe, Donovan, Wright, Craig, Jarrett, Steele, Quinn, Kirk, Crafts, Allan, Waller, Martin, Smith, Harrison, Evans, Hatten, Algic, and a number of Natives.
